The Noble Houses of Westeros

The Great Houses are the most powerful of the noble houses of the Seven Kingdoms. They exercise immense authority and power over their vassals and territories and are answerable only to the King of the Andals, the Rhoynar, and the First Men, with the exception of House Stark, which rules over an independent kingdom.
The Great Houses are often distinguished by their sigils, words, and notable members. House Stark, for example, is known for its direwolf sigil and the words "Winter is Coming." House Lannister, on the other hand, is recognized by its golden lion sigil and the words "Hear Me Roar!" House Targaryen, the family of the former ruling dynasty, is identified by its three-headed dragon sigil and the words "Fire and Blood."
